My Time line is as below:
EV Request: October 2012 ( a reminder sent in January & granted in February 20th, 2013)
Eploratory Visit : February 25th, 2013-March 15th, 2013
Exploratory visit Interview : March 15th, 2013
Letter of Invitation to apply : March 15th, 2013
MPNP Application Submitted : March 30th, 2013
Additional Document & Phone Interview: July 8th, 2013
LOA : Still waiting
Interview was centered on my movement within Canada, because I had travelled to Saskatoon to attend a 2 day church program after my interview and flew from there back to Montreal airport to connect my flight back home. Just that that am a bit scared on why the requested for all flight details to be sent. anyway i have sent it to them and did a letter explaining my movement within Canada and stressing that I do not have any other relative in Canada apart from the few people I met at winnipeg during my exploratory visit, a log of all my activities while in Winnipeg was also attached to all the documents sent
Have an idea of what LOA will arrive?
